Output 175391c363d9400258a68002fa53bf0b00b002a06519a1bf3d9e76e709a5c8b6:0

value
614000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a029cdccd274b780caeb4bcc5fae39953f0099c OP_EQUAL
address
3QUwz3A71azXi6jVmm81AL3dwDbbyF99nf
transaction
175391c363d9400258a68002fa53bf0b00b002a06519a1bf3d9e76e709a5c8b6
confirmations
308440
spent
true